The netmeta package is specialized for implementing network meta-analysis. This package was developed based on the theories of classical frequentist under R language framework. The netmeta package overcomes some difficulties of the software and/or packages based on the theories of Bayesian, for these software and/or packages need to set prior value when conducting network meta-analysis. The netmeta package also has the advantages of simple operation process and ease to operate. Moreover, this package can calculate and present the individual matched and pooled results based on the random and fixed effect model at the same time. It also can draw forest plots. This article gives a briefly introduction to show the process to conduct network meta-analysis using netmeta package.
Systematic reviews and meta-analyses have become the cornerstone methodologies for integrating multi-source research data and enhancing the quality of evidence. Traditional meta-analyses often demonstrate limitations when handling multiple treatment options. Network meta-analysis (NMA) overcomes these limitations by constructing a network of evidence that encompasses various treatment options, allowing for the simultaneous comparison of both direct and indirect evidence across multiple treatment plans. This provides more comprehensive and precise support for clinical decision-making. This article comprehensively reviews the statistical principles of NMA, its three fundamental assumptions, and the statistical inference framework. It also critically analyzes the mainstream NMA software and packages currently available, such as R (including gemtc, netmeta, rjags, pcnetmeta), Stata (mvmeta, network), WinBUGS, SAS, ADDIS, and various online applications, highlighting their strengths, weaknesses, and suitable scenarios. This analysis provides researchers with a scientific and unified framework for conducting clinical studies and policy-making.